Wayeyi Traditional crafts
The main producers of baskets are the women of the Wayeyi and Hambukushu tribes in northwestern Botswana in Gumare and Etsha villages. The closed baskets with lids are used for storing grain, seeds, and sometimes sorghum beer. Large, open bowl shaped baskets are used by the women for carrying items on their heads and for winnowing grain after it has been threshed.
